首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

react-本机日期未作为转换的时区返回

问题:react-本机日期未作为转换的时区返回是什么意思?

回答:react-本机日期未作为转换的时区返回是指在使用React框架开发应用时,当获取本机日期并进行时区转换时,可能会出现时区转换错误的情况。这通常是由于React框架默认使用UTC时间进行日期处理,而本机日期可能处于不同的时区,导致转换时出现偏差。

为了解决这个问题,可以使用第三方库moment.js来处理日期和时区转换。moment.js是一个流行的JavaScript日期处理库,它提供了丰富的日期操作方法和时区转换功能,可以帮助开发者轻松处理日期和时区的相关问题。

在React应用中使用moment.js可以按照以下步骤进行:

  1. 首先,安装moment.js库。可以使用npm或yarn命令进行安装:
  2. 首先,安装moment.js库。可以使用npm或yarn命令进行安装:
  3. 在需要处理日期和时区的组件中,引入moment.js库:
  4. 在需要处理日期和时区的组件中,引入moment.js库:
  5. 使用moment.js提供的方法来获取本机日期并进行时区转换。例如,获取当前日期并转换为指定时区的日期:
  6. 使用moment.js提供的方法来获取本机日期并进行时区转换。例如,获取当前日期并转换为指定时区的日期:
  7. 上述代码中,moment()用于获取当前本机日期,.tz('Asia/Shanghai')用于将日期转换为指定时区(这里以亚洲/上海时区为例),.format('YYYY-MM-DD HH:mm:ss')用于格式化日期输出。
  8. 注意:在使用时区转换功能时,需要提前安装moment-timezone库,并在代码中引入相应的时区数据。可以使用以下命令进行安装:
  9. 注意:在使用时区转换功能时,需要提前安装moment-timezone库,并在代码中引入相应的时区数据。可以使用以下命令进行安装:
  10. 引入时区数据的方法如下:
  11. 引入时区数据的方法如下:

以上是解决react-本机日期未作为转换的时区返回问题的一种方法。通过使用moment.js库,我们可以方便地处理日期和时区转换,并确保获取到正确的本机日期。

推荐的腾讯云相关产品:腾讯云函数(云函数是一种无需管理服务器即可运行代码的计算服务,可以用于处理日期和时区转换等任务)、腾讯云容器服务(提供容器化应用的部署、管理和扩展能力,可用于部署React应用)、腾讯云数据库(提供多种数据库服务,可用于存储和管理应用中的数据)。

腾讯云函数产品介绍链接地址:https://cloud.tencent.com/product/scf

腾讯云容器服务产品介绍链接地址:https://cloud.tencent.com/product/ccs

腾讯云数据库产品介绍链接地址:https://cloud.tencent.com/product/cdb

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

相关资讯

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券